Description leftcrane 2021-05-14 12:36:05 UTC
I'm not sure if KSystemLog has the ability to view logs from the previous boot but if it's there, it's not accessible to the user. I don't see it in the UI and you can't open the help page because the log viewer gui runs as root.

So I'm not sure if this option is missing or just extremely difficult to find but as far as the user is concerned it doesn't exist. This means it's impossible to use the program to troubleshoot critical system failures (ones that end with a shut down)
Comment 1 Philipp A. 2024-06-19 08:42:10 UTC
Confirmed. The setting “Journdald” → “Only show log entries since the system start” doesn’t seem to do anything
